[CANADA] Less than two years after he was hired, Dale Mitchell has been fired as Canada's national team coach. Mitchell, whose contract was to run through 2010, was ousted following another humiliating World Cup qualifying campaign. Canada failed to win any of its six games and finished last in its ...
